Copycat Costco Cinnamon Bread - Easy & Sweet

This homemade Copycat Costco Cinnamon Bread is soft, fluffy, and packed with swirls of cinnamon sugar. Perfect for breakfast or a sweet snack!

Ingredients

  • 3 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 packet (2 1/4 tsp) instant yeast
  • 1 cup warm milk
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 egg
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 2 tbsp cinnamon
  • 2 tbsp melted butter (for brushing)

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, mix warm milk, sugar, and yeast. Let it sit for 5 minutes until foamy.
  2. Add melted butter, egg, and salt, then mix in flour gradually.
  3. Knead the dough for 8-10 minutes until smooth, then let it rise for 1 hour.
  4. Roll out the dough into a rectangle and brush with melted butter.
  5. Mix brown sugar and cinnamon, then sprinkle over the dough.
  6. Roll the dough tightly, place it in a greased loaf pan, and let rise for another 30 minutes.
  7. Bake at 350°F (175°C) for 30-35 minutes until golden brown.
  8. Let it cool before slicing and serving.
